National Prayer Day Set for Thursday

Share
Associated Press

President Reagan and both houses of Congress have proclaimed Thursday as a National Day of Prayer, with many churches and communities setting special observances.

A task force on the day urges Americans to focus on acknowledging dependence on God, renewing personal and corporate moral values and seeking God’s guidance for the nation’s leaders.

Americans also were urged to pledge themselves to the restoration of marriage and family commitments and to offer thanks for the many blessings the country has received through the years.
